The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s requiring JavaScript sk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 8 July 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
8 Jul 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 88 35 35
Rank change year-on-year -53 0 -6
Contract jobs citing JavaScript 1,524 1,695 2,240
As % of all contract jobs in the UK 2.92% 5.31% 5.19%
As % of the Programming Languages category 10.85% 15.81% 16.88%
Number of daily rates quoted 1,101 1,199 1,571
10th Percentile £350 £331 £325
25th Percentile £413 £406 £425
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£510 £515 £528
Median % change year-on-year -0.97% -2.46% +0.57%
75th Percentile £625 £650 £688
90th Percentile £788 £825 £850
UK excluding London median daily rate £488 £475 £450
% change year-on-year +2.63% +5.56% -6.20%
